Frigate ‘Santa María’ partakes in the European Union Maritime Security conferences in Oman

Muscat Port, Oman
February 3, 2023
  • During its stay in the Omani Capital, the vessel received several official visits related to the Northwest Indian Ocean Security

Spain’s frigate ‘Santa María’, within the ATALANTA operation, did a stopover at the Muscat Port from 29 JAN to 02 FEB. The frigate partook in the different planned activities on the occasion of the ‘Renown EU Maritime Security Event.’ It was organised together with the Omani authorities - the Operation Force Commander along with many EU authorities and the AGENOR Operation were aboard.

On 29 JAN, the vessel welcomed the official visit from the Spanish Ambassador to Oman, María Luisa Huidobro Martín-Laborda. The boarding took place with the traditional Spanish Navy ‘voice salute’ from the personnel plus the highest pertinent naval honours. During her stay on board, the Ambassador confirmed the frigate capabilities in operation’s area.

On 30 JAN, a conference between the EU representatives and the Omani took place in the Muscat ‘Maritime Security Center’ (MSC) to discuss on Maritime Security in the Pacific Ocean. Later, a reception aboard the frigate presided by the Ambassador to the UE, the Ambassador to Spain in Oman and the Operation Force Commander took place. Many UE Ambassadors attended, as well as Omani authorities and military attachés; part of the Spanish community in Oman also attended.

The Force Commander of the ‘ATALANTA’ operation aboard the ‘Santa María’, made several official visits to the Joint Chief of Staff and the Omani Navy plus the Omani Coast Police. The visit of the Senior Coordinator from the ‘Northwest Indian Ocean’ (NWIO), the EU ‘CRIMARIO II’ representative and the Force Commander from the ‘AGENOR’ operation.
